1. Resident State

The Ododop people reside in Cross River state of Nigeria. The state is found in the south south geopolitical zone of Nigeria.

8. Neighbouring Languages

There are other languages that surround the Ododop people. Some of them are Lokaah, Ubang, Yala, Eki, Ibibio as well as Efik.
